Looks like you're using a "point an shoot" camera behind an eyepiece.

A low power eyepice should be used, say 25mm.

You need an Afocal camera adaptor to hold the camera square and in line with the optical axis of the eyepiece.

Adaptors

I'd say your images are over exposed, try a faster setting on the shutter if you can.

assuming you focused the scope first visually, the camera focus should be set to infinity - have you got a setting for that? Also, if the camera is seeing a lot of dark sky, it might be over exposing to compensate. Have you got the camera settings (exif) data from your shots?

oh, you say "the distance between my compact digital camera lens and my secondary mirror is about 5cm", are you using an eyepiece, is the camera actually inside the tube??
